Evaluating 290 reviews, most reviewers were let down by their experience overall. Many people found the customer service to be unhelpful, with issues like language barriers and a lack of empathy from staff. Customers frequently reported problems with payments, including funds being held, incorrect charges, and difficulties resolving disputes. Reviewers also expressed dissatisfaction with the service, citing instances where their credit limits were decreased without clear reasons and challenges in getting assistance with fraud protection. Some people also felt that the staff lacked accountability and training, leading to frustrating and unresolved issues.

I need someone from Coporate HQ to…

I need someone from Coporate HQ to resolve a situation that has been going on for months. Verizon owed me $65.94 for failure to set up an account and port my phone number. I originally filed a dispute with Citi. Citi wasn't resolving the investigation because Verizon's bank was not responding because I was told they are just a processing center and therefore would not respond. Verizon reps suggested that I wirhdraw the dispute with Citi so they could refund me. So, I did that. But, then Verizon later stated they could not refund me because Citi put their chargeback money into a holding account which they cannot access. Then I tried to reopen the dispute with Citi and was told they cannot reopen it. So, as of now, Citi has my $65.94 owed to me by Verizon and Verizon's $65.94 in chargeback money. The disputes department is refusing to refund me and Verizon. I need and want my money back. I am tired of this situation. I have filed complaints with the BBB, AZ Office of Inspector General and been in touch with Verizon and sending emails to Citi disputes department with no resolution to date. I need Citi to give me my money or Citi to give Verizon their chargeback money currently in a holding account the Citi rep said so Verizon can refund me. I'm beginning to hate Citi too like I do Verizon. It's making me want to payoff my bill and close my accounts with Citi with Best Buy and Citi Double Cash Card. I'm over both Verizon and Citi. I've bern trying to get my money back for months.
